Story Overview:
Years after settling into his swamp-side version of happiness, Shrek finds himself facing a problem no ogre ever prepares for — change. His kids are growing up, Fairy Tale Land is evolving, and the world beyond the swamp is louder, faster, and stranger than ever.
When a new ruler rises with a polished vision of “perfect fairy tales,” ogres, talking animals, and misfit creatures are quietly pushed aside. What begins as a harmless modernization soon threatens to erase everything that makes the fairy-tale world weird, wild, and real.
Pulled back into adventure, Shrek teams up with Fiona, Donkey, Puss in Boots, and a new generation of unlikely heroes to challenge a future that forgets the past. Along the way, Shrek must confront his greatest fear — not being needed anymore.
The journey proves that family isn’t about endings, legends aren’t about perfection, and being yourself never goes out of style.
